Ok, so, after a bit of sleuthing, & registering on Xbox insider, the new sim will probably be available from Xbox Games Pass!

(https://news.xbox.com/en-us/2019/06/09/xbox-e3-2019-briefing-recap/)

Microsoft Flight Simulator (Xbox One And Windows 10 PC)
The next generation of our longest-running franchise, Microsoft Flight Simulator is coming to Windows 10 with Xbox Game Pass in 2020, and coming to Xbox One at a later date. Microsoft Flight Simulator is specifically designed to celebrate flight simulation fans through a focus on the authenticity of flying and visually stunning environments. By revamping our tech, working in close collaboration with the community and pursuing the best partnerships across the industry, we intend to deliver the best-in-class flight simulation experience. 

https://www.xbox.com/en-US/xbox-game-pass/pc-games

with a monthly fee, apart from any cost of game.

I dont think it will work like that, unless something has changed.

 

Currently Xbox gamepass is a subscription thing and gives you access to lots of games without having to purchase them outright. Obviously once the subscription stops you will no longer have access to play those games any more. 

You don't have to subscribe though, you can just buy the game outright, and its yours to keep forever (in theory). I don't think that will be changing in the near term.
